概述
TPWallet(下称“钱包”)作为多链数字资产管理工具,近年来在用户端和DApp生态中应用广泛。本文从支持币种、钱包功能、安全防护(含防代码注入与随机数生成)、数字支付管理、对智能化社会发展的作用及专家评估角度进行综合性介绍。
1. 支持的币种与链
TPWallet 通常支持主流公链原生币(如 BTC、ETH、BNB、TRX、SOL、ADA、DOT 等)以及各链上的代币标准(ERC-20、BEP-20、TRC-20、SPL 等)。同时支持稳定币(USDT、USDC、DAI 等)、主流链上 NFT,以及部分 Layer-2 和跨链资产。不同版本或接入插件会影响具体币种,使用前应在官方或源码仓库核验支持清单。
2. 钱包核心功能
- 账户管理:创建/导入私钥、助记词(BIP39)、多账号切换、硬件钱包连接。
- 转账与手续费管理:可设置自定义 Gas/手续费、交易加速、交易记录查询。
- 资产管理:分类展示、价格聚合、代币添加/隐藏、NFT 收藏夹。
- 交易与互换:内置去中心化交易所(Swap)、聚合器接口、限价/市价支持(视集成程度)。
- Staking 与治理:支持委托质押、参与链上治理投票。
- 跨链与桥接:集成桥接服务或调用外部跨链网关。
- DApp 浏览器与授权管理:连接 DApp、权限回溯与签名审批。
3. 防代码注入与运行时隔离
为防御代码注入与恶意脚本,钱包通常采取多层防护:前端输入校验与内容安全策略(CSP)、对第三方脚本的白名单与签名验证、严格的权限模型(最小权限原则)、将签名操作限制在本地沙箱或硬件安全模块(HSM/TEE)内执行、对扩展或插件实行沙箱化和代码审计流程。此外,签名请求应始终在用户可见上下文展示完整交易信息以防“签名欺骗”。
4. 随机数生成与密钥安全
高质量随机数对私钥与助记词生成至关重要。优秀的钱包采用多源熵收集(设备熵、系统随机、用户交互熵)、经现代加密学验证的 CSPRNG(密码安全伪随机数生成器)、以及支持硬件随机数发生器(TRNG)。对于确定性钱包(HD 钱包),采用 BIP39/BIP32 等标准,同时提供助记词加密与离线备份建议。任何随机数生成模块应可审计并提供熵熵池来源说明。
5. 数字支付管理能力
TPWallet 在数字支付场景中可提供:多币种收付、商户收款二维码、自动汇率与费用估算、可配置的最小确认数、批量付款与自动化支付(结合智能合约)、以及发票/账单管理接口。企业级部署还会支持多签、角色与权限控制、支出审批流程与审计日志,以满足合规与财务管理需求。
6. 对智能化社会发展的贡献
作为基础金融基础设施,钱包推动价值互联网、去中心化身份(DID)、微支付与物联网支付落地。钱包与身份服务结合可实现自主管理的数字证书与可信认证;与智能合约配合支持自动化服务结算、创新社保/补贴发放模式。隐私保护技术(零知识证明、链下计算)在钱包层的集成,将影响未来智能社会中个人数据与资产自治的平衡。
7. 专家评估要点(简要)
安全性:重点审计密钥管理、随机数生成、签名流程及第三方依赖。
可用性:助记词恢复流程、用户界面提示及多语言支持。
合规与隐私:KYC/AML 接口的可选集成与用户隐私最小化原则。
互操作性:对主流公链与跨链桥的接入质量。
可审计性:开源或提供可验证的安全报告、有无第三方渗透测试与证明。
8. 建议与风险提示
- 验证来源:仅从官方渠道下载并核验签名。
- 私钥与助记词:离线备份、分散存储、避免云端明文保存。
- 权限最小化:审慎授权 DApp、定期清理已授权的合约权限。
- 多重防护:对大额资产使用硬件钱包或多签方案。
结语

TPWallet 类钱包在支持丰富币种与便捷功能的同时,必须在密钥管理、随机性保证、代码注入防护与支付合规上持续加强。对企业与个人而言,理解其安全模型与合规边界、选择合适的备份与多重保护策略,是在智能化社会迈向数字支付与链上治理时代的基本前提。

评论
SkyLancer
内容全面,尤其是对随机数和防注入的强调很到位。
小桥流水
讲得清楚,建议补充各版本钱包对具体链的兼容差异。
CryptoNinja
关于企业级多签与审批流程能否举个实操案例?期待后续深入。
梅子菇凉
安全建议实用,尤其是硬件钱包与多签的推荐,值得收藏。